Do hoarding cleanup services offer follow-up support?
Yes, many hoarding cleanup services offer follow-up support to help clients maintain a clutter-free home. Follow-up visits, organizational coaching, and referrals to mental health professionals are common post-cleanup services. Some companies provide scheduled check-ins or maintenance cleanings to prevent relapse. Ongoing support ensures that individuals can sustain their progress and develop long-term healthy habits.

?What causes persistent odors in homes or businesses?
Persistent odors can stem from various sources such as biological matter, smoke damage, mold growth, or industrial spills. Professionals identify the root cause using advanced diagnostic tools. Biological matter, like pet accidents or food spills, can emit foul smells if not cleaned properly. Smoke damage, whether from cigarettes or fires, embeds particles into surfaces, requiring specialized cleaning. Mold thrives in damp environments, producing a musty odor that persists until the mold is eradicated. Industrial spills may release chemical odors that need expert handling. Professional odor removal services address these issues comprehensively, ensuring the source is eliminated and the space is restored to a fresh state.
